The remote reference is calculated once every scan
interval and initially consists of two types of reference
inputs:

1.
X (the external reference): A sum (see
3-04 Reference Function) of up to four externally
selected references, comprising any combination
(determined by the setting of 3-15 Reference
Resource 1, 3-16 Reference Resource 2 and
3-17 Reference Resource 3) of a fixed preset
reference (3-10 Preset Reference), variable analog
references, variable digital pulse references, and
various serial bus references in whatever unit the
frequency converter is controlled ([Hz], [RPM],
[Nm] etc.).
2.
Y- (the relative reference): A sum of one fixed
preset reference (3-14 Preset Relative Reference)
and one variable analog reference (3-18 Relative
Scaling Reference Resource) in [%].
The two types of reference inputs are combined in the
following formula: Remote reference=X+X*Y/100%. If
relative reference is not used 3-18 Relative Scaling Reference
Resource must be set to No function and to 0%. The catch
up/slow down function and the freeze reference function
can both be activated by digital inputs on the frequency
converter. The functions and parameters are described in
the Programming Guide.
The scaling of analog references are described in
parameter groups 6-1* and 6-2*, and the scaling of digital
pulse references are described in parameter group 5-5*.
Reference limits and ranges are set in parameter group
3-0*.

2.3.1 Reference Limits

3-00 Reference Range, 3-02 Minimum Reference and
3-03 Maximum Reference together define the allowed range
of the sum of all references. The sum of all references are
clamped when necessary. The relation between the
resulting reference (after clamping) is shown in
Illustration 2.10/Illustration 2.11 and the sum of all
references is shown in Illustration 2.12.

The value of 3-02 Minimum Reference can not be set to less
than 0, unless1-00 Configuration Mode is set to [3] Process.
In that case the following relations between the resulting
reference (after clamping) and the sum of all references is
as shown in Illustration 2.12.
